Come lavorare con file CSV in PowerShell

Come Lavorare Con File Csv In Powershell



Un CSV è fondamentalmente un file di testo che viene salvato con l'estensione '. csv 'estensione. Contiene i valori separati da virgole. Memorizza i dati in forma tabellare in un semplice file di testo. Normalmente viene creato utilizzando l'applicazione Microsoft Excel, tuttavia può anche essere creato con PowerShell. PowerShell dispone di alcuni comandi che possono creare, visualizzare, importare o esportare file CSV.

Questo articolo esaminerà i vari metodi per lavorare con i file CSV.







Come lavorare con i file CSV in PowerShell?

Con PowerShell gli utenti possono:



Esempio 1: esportare e creare un file CSV utilizzando PowerShell

Per esportare o creare un file CSV, innanzitutto inserisci il comando di cui desideri esportare i dati in un file CSV. Quindi, collega il comando a ' Esporta-CSV ' insieme al cmdlet '- Sentiero 'parametro a cui è assegnato il percorso del file CSV di destinazione:



Ottieni servizio | Esporta-Csv -Percorso C:\Nuovo\Servizio.csv





Esempio 2: visualizzare i dati CSV

Dopo aver creato il file CSV, gli utenti possono vedere i dati all'interno del file CSV. Per questo motivo, utilizzare innanzitutto il comando “ Ottieni contenuto 'cmdlet e assegnargli il percorso del file CSV:

Get-Contenuto C:\Nuovo\Servizio.csv



Esempio 3: importare dati CSV

Gli utenti possono anche importare i dati utilizzando PowerShell. Per fare ciò, per prima cosa, scrivi il ' Importa-CSV ' e quindi specificare l'indirizzo del file CSV. Infine, per visualizzare i dati CSV nel formato tabella, è sufficiente inserire l'intero comando nel cmdlet 'ft':

Importa-CSV -Percorso C:\Nuovo\Dati.csv | piedi

Si può osservare che i dati sono stati importati da un file CSV in PowerShell.

Conclusione

Per lavorare con i file CSV, PowerShell dispone di diversi comandi. Questi comandi possono aiutare gli utenti a visualizzare, importare o esportare dati all'interno dei file CSV. Questo post ha approfondito la gestione dei file CSV utilizzando i comandi di PowerShell.